Wow, congratulations! I'm just a lightweight at 68k on my '01 but I have to say, this is the best car I've ever owned.

A quick word about maintenance, there are specific things that are done at specific miles and can be quite extensive but these maintenances are what keep them running.

Try to find out if the "big" maintenances were done and if not, spring for the biggie which includes all fluids, water pump, cam belt and some other stuff. If you really want to get the long miles this is important.
